Online baccarat is one of the simplest casino table games once you understand the structure. You are not playing against other players directly; you are betting on the outcome of two hands: Player and Banker. A third option is Tie. Cards are dealt according to fixed drawing rules, so there is no strategic decision like in blackjack after the bet is placed. This makes baccarat attractive for players who prefer clean decision-making and lower cognitive load. In live dealer baccarat, the pace is slower and more immersive, while RNG baccarat is faster and better for shorter sessions. In both formats, bankroll discipline matters more than superstition systems.
| Bet Type | Typical House Edge | Payout | Best Use Case |
|---|---|---|---|
| Banker | ~1.06% | 1:1 (minus 5% commission) | Most consistent long-session option |
| Player | ~1.24% | 1:1 | Simple alternative without commission |
| Tie | High | Usually 8:1 or 9:1 | High-risk occasional shot only |
Many online baccarat tables in 2026 include side bets such as Player Pair, Banker Pair, Perfect Pair, or Big/Small. These markets can look attractive because payouts are larger, but they normally come with higher variance and a bigger long-term house edge. For most Romanian players, side bets should be treated as entertainment extras, not as a main strategy. If your goal is session stability, it is usually better to focus on Banker and Player bets and keep stake sizing conservative. Side bets can be used occasionally with a pre-set cap, for example a small fixed amount every few rounds. This keeps variance manageable and prevents emotional overbetting.

Not every welcome bonus is equally useful for baccarat. A large number may look impressive, but the practical value depends on wagering, game weighting, max cashout limits, and minimum odds-style restrictions where relevant. For baccarat players, the key question is contribution rate: does baccarat count 100%, partially, or not at all? As of June 2026, many casinos still give better contribution to slots than table games. That does not mean baccarat players should ignore bonuses entirely, but they should treat offers as secondary to game access and withdrawal quality. A medium-sized, transparent offer is often better than a huge package with restrictive terms.
| Factor | Why It Matters | Good Benchmark |
|---|---|---|
| Wagering Requirement | Determines turnover needed before withdrawal | 30x-40x range |
| Baccarat Contribution | Controls whether your play counts | Clearly disclosed and fair |
| Max Conversion / Cashout | Limits real bonus profitability | No overly restrictive cap |
| Validity Period | Affects realistic completion chance | At least 7-14 days |

Baccarat has a reputation for simplicity, but emotional volatility is still intense because outcomes are binary and fast. Even when you mostly bet Banker or Player, short-term streaks can feel meaningful and push you into overconfidence or panic. The antidote is process-based play: fixed unit size, pre-defined stop points, and no mid-session rule changes. If you use pattern reading, treat it as a decision framework, not prediction certainty. Emotional control is not about never feeling pressure; it is about having pre-committed actions when pressure appears. The players who last are usually the ones who can execute boring discipline repeatedly.

Bankroll management is where baccarat sessions are won or lost long before the cards are dealt. Because the game moves quickly online, poor staking discipline can destroy a budget in minutes, even with “safe” bet choices. A robust model starts with a dedicated bankroll, separate from living expenses, then divides that bankroll into session units. Most disciplined players use fixed units and avoid progressive systems that escalate risk after losses. The goal is not to eliminate variance—it is to survive it while keeping decision quality intact. If you cannot explain your staking plan in one minute, it is probably too complicated to execute under pressure.
| Approach | How it works | Strength | Main danger |
|---|---|---|---|
| Fixed-unit staking | Same bet size per hand or simple capped adjustments | Predictable risk exposure | Can feel slow during winning runs |
| Positive progression | Increase stake after wins | Presses momentum carefully | Gives back profits if not capped |
| Negative progression (e.g., Martingale variants) | Increase stake after losses | Can recover small streaks in theory | Explosive risk and table-limit collisions |
| Profile | Session units | Suggested risk posture |
|---|---|---|
| Conservative | 80–120 units | Small stakes, strict stop rules, minimal side bets |
| Balanced | 50–80 units | Moderate flexibility with capped adjustments |
| Aggressive recreational | 30–50 units | Higher variance tolerance, shorter sessions |

Once fundamentals are in place, table selection becomes a major edge in risk control. Not an edge over house math, but an edge over your own worst habits. Different tables have different speed, limits, side-bet menus, and dealer cadence, all of which influence bankroll burn and mental state. Advanced players often preselect two or three table types and rotate based on session goals rather than emotion. Side bets deserve special caution: they are exciting and can produce memorable hits, but they usually carry higher house edge and variance. A disciplined framework lets you enjoy them occasionally without letting them dominate your expected losses.
| Speed profile | Approx rounds/hour | Bankroll effect |
|---|---|---|
| Slow live table | 35–45 | Lower burn rate, more reflection time |
| Standard live table | 45–60 | Balanced pace for most players |
| Fast RNG table | 80+ | High burn risk without strict limits |
